Handover note — Crumbwheel order cutoffs.

Welcome aboard. The bakery cutoff rule in Crumbwheel closes same-day orders at 14:00 local to each storefront, not UTC — this has bitten us twice. Holiday overrides live in the calendar service and take precedence silently, so always check there first when a cutoff looks wrong. To unlock the calendar service's admin console after a restart, enter the recovery passphrase below.

vault phrase of bagap-bahaf = silion-pelox-sorox-casdor-quenwyn-fraax-eliox-praael-kelion-quenvan-kasox-rusael-norius-belvan

Quick note for the sync: the Marlowind telemetry pipeline now gzips payloads before they hit the Pindrop collector, cutting egress by ~40%. Compression happens client-side in the agent, so nothing changes server-side except the content-encoding check. If you're testing locally, point the agent at the staging collector and use the shared key, which is pasted right here.

API key for yahig-tadup: kto7_ubizbYm

The Quellbox alert deduplicator drops custom fingerprints returned by third-party enrichment plugins when alerts arrive within the same 30s window. Result: duplicates page twice. Affects plugins built against API v3 only; v2 shims unaffected. Workaround: set dedupe.fingerprint_source=plugin explicitly in your manifest. Fix lands in the next minor release; plugin authors should retest against the patched build. Reproduce with the sample alert bundle attached to this ticket and reference the trace token below when reporting results.

pipeline stamp: htk9_ce63042d9

### Runbook: driver-assignment heuristic acting up

If Pondlark routes start pairing far-away drivers with nearby jobs, the distance-decay weight has probably drifted after a config push. Quick check: compare assigned-vs-nearest distance in the ops panel; anything over 2x means trouble. Flip the heuristic to `balanced-legacy` mode and ping dispatch engineering. Note which build you saw it on — the current one is stamped below.

session token of fahap-hawip = htk31_7852f2b3276dba2738f98fa97f92237